Dan Xu is a scholar working on Atomic and Molecular Physics, and Optics, Electronic, Optical and Magnetic Materials and Condensed Matter Physics. According to data from OpenAlex, Dan Xu has authored 40 papers receiving a total of 1.0k ind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Atomic and Molecular Physics, and Optics, 13 papers in Electronic, Optical and Magnetic Materials and 8 papers in Condensed Matter Physics. Recurrent topics in Dan Xu’s work include Iron-based superconductors research (13 papers), Advanced Frequency and Time Standards (8 papers) and Advanced Fiber Laser Technologies (8 papers). Dan Xu is often cited by papers focused on Iron-based superconductors research (13 papers), Advanced Frequency and Time Standards (8 papers) and Advanced Fiber Laser Technologies (8 papers). Dan Xu collaborates with scholars based in China, France and United Kingdom. Dan Xu's co-authors include X. H. Niu, Donglai Feng, Juan Jiang, Haiwen Cai, B. P. Xie, Rui Peng, Dijun Chen, Fang Wei, Pavel Dudin and B. P. Xie and has published in prestigious journals such as Physical Review Letters, Physical Review B and Acta Materialia.
